What happens while it is decided

The process from here

This application is with Stockport for determination. The council publicises it, consults neighbours and technical bodies where required, and weighs the responses against local and national planning policy.

The statutory target is eight weeks for most applications and thirteen for major development, though extensions of time are common. Comments carry most weight while the case is undecided, so check the council portal for the deadline if you want to respond.

About full applications applications

How this application type works

A full application seeks permission for a complete, detailed proposal in one go: siting, design, access and landscaping are all fixed at this stage. It is the standard route for new buildings, conversions and changes of use. The statutory target is eight weeks for smaller schemes and thirteen weeks for major development, though complex cases often take longer by agreement.
